Wit penetrates; humor envelops. Wit is a function of verbal intelligence; humor is imagination operating on good nature.
Interpretation
What this quote means
Wit is sharp and intelligent, while humor is more about warmth and creativity.
This quote by Peggy Noonan highlights the difference between wit and humor. Wit is characterized by its cleverness and sharpness, requiring a certain level of verbal intelligence to convey quick, insightful remarks. In contrast, humor encompasses a broader spectrum where imagination meets a disposition of goodwill, creating laughter and joy that envelops others. Essentially, while wit can be cutting or incisive, humor is more gentle and inclusive, fostering a sense of connection and positivity.
